in terms of the crowd, well after mystikz play people generally tend to leave regardless because some tend to go home at that time but in this case i think it was more so because the conditions in room 1 were too much and people didnt wanna stay for skream and benga. so the room was generally a bit thinner but still quite filled when youngsta came on. i did notice people leaving but really it just made me happier because i wanted the space and the heat to drop so i could enjoy it.

space definately works for me, i dont care if the rooms thin, as long as the crowd that is there are responding. i guess in terms of reaction tho, ye the crowd goes a bit more mental for the hype dj's but at dmz the deep sets do go down nicely aswell allbeit with a smaller crowd. its just the way the genre is skewed and because its so big you can see it even at dmz to an extent - that is people go for it more when the tear out is played. but it dont matter cos you still get proper bass heads into the more subby stuff who support it at dmz, well you used to anyways i dunno now.

this reminds me of when kryptic minds played a graveyard set at dmz and the crowd generally left to go home (not so much because of the music but because of tierdness etc) but those who did stick it out got a real treat. was about 20-30 of us in the main room with tune after tune on that system with nice space to skank, was probably one of the best sets i've seen at dmz in recent times.
